Hawks Aloft

Description

Fall is peak season for migrating raptors, and from the top of the drumlin, the view is spectacular. Start with a close-up encounter with one of Drumlin Farm's wildlife ambassador hawks, learning to read the details and behaviors that makes each species special.

Then, set out on a guided hike up the drumlin to scan the skies for migrating hawks, falcons, and eagles riding thermals south for the winter. A naturalist helps participants identify raptors by silhouette, size, and flight style along the way. Round out the adventure with a flying bird craft to take home as a keepsake from your sky-high afternoon.
